Design Innovation

Plate manifold technology revolutionizes fluid management by enabling the transition from traditional valve, hose, and pipe systems to distributed plate manifolds. Many products can benefit from key features and core benefits of this technology.

Key Features

  • Multi-Port Capabilities: Ensures precise control over fluid velocity and pressure, accommodating multiple inlet/discharge ports for diverse fluid management needs.​

  • Customizable Flow Manifold Plates: Engineered to handle various fluids, pressures and/or feedback adjustments -- tailored to specific operational requirements.​

  • Accommodates Misalignment: Works well even when fluid ports are not aligned on mating components.

Core Benefits

  • Simplification of Complex Assembly:

    • Consolidation of Parts: Results in a lean inventory and streamlines assembly process. Reduce bill of materials (BOM) from multiple valves, tubes, and seals to one part number.​

    • Integrated Reliable Sealing: Eliminates failure due to improper seal installation; Overcomes seal retention issues with permanently bonded elastomers, eliminating necessity of costly groove machining.

  • Space Efficiency:

    • Compact Design: Plate manifolds are designed to be both compact and efficient, significantly saving space.​

    • Weight Reduction: Component reduction contributes to reduced weight for easier handling and transport.​

    • Optimized for End-Use: The compact nature of plate manifolds ensures they occupy less space allowing for greater flexibility and more aesthetic design options. They are easier to transport, store and ship efficiently. 

  • Performance Enhancement:

    • Fluid Flow Control: Plate manifolds provide unparalleled control over fluid flow in complex environments, including multi-port, multi-fluid, multi-pressure requirements.

Sustainable Energy

Bi-Polar Plates for Fuel Cells & Electrolyzers

Bipolar plates provide reliable sealing for stacks in fuel cells and electrolyzers, controlling media flow along the design path. They prevent leaks and electrolyte loss, ensuring performance of the total system.

Automotive Electric Vehicle

Centralized Thermal Management Systems (CTMS)

Plate manifold technology is an upgraded alternative to traditional distributed cooling for electric vehicle battery packs. Plate manifold technology does away with complex, multiple valve assemblies, enabling centralized fluid control and thermal management of critical battery systems.
